Adidas and Arte Antwerp Celebrate North African Football Culture in New Collaboration
Featuring tracksuits, tees and knitted jerseys.
Arte Antwerp has joined forces with adidas to drop a sportswear collection heavily-influenced by North Africa’s rich football culture. The head-to-toe collaboration arrives in the colors of the Moroccan and Algerian flags, and the Belgian streetwear brand elevates adidas’ sportswear range with effortlessly cool sets, sandals and jerseys. A campaign shot in Morocco by Ilyes Griyeb brings the collection to life against red clay and tile.
The collaboration focuses on the basics: tracksuits, tees and simple jerseys. The color palette is made up of red and white, with splashes of green, black and navy to create a capsule that is filled with national pride and North African style. Arte takes the adidas Z.N.E tracksuit and gives it a softer, more refined touch with scalloped stitching. Red and white oversized jerseys are paired with matching shorts for the full kit look.
Knitted jerseys steal the show, available in black and white with red and green details. To complete the collection, caps, crossbody bags, Adilette slides and socks add the finishing touches to every fit.
